Even monsters must have rules and The Chain is the covert agency tasked to ensuring those rules are obeyed. Agents of The Chain maintain the balance between the various supernatural forces that prey on humanity. No one group or individual is allowed to grow in power to the point where they might truly threaten humanity’s status quo.

Formed out self-interest rather than altruism, The Chain was originally founded by a group of monsters that took a look at mankind and knew how to spot a good scam when they saw one. Why seek to wipe-out humanity or bring about Ragnarok when you’ve got a few billion little meals and playthings just wandering around obliviously?

All agents of The Chain wear a shackle – an enchanted iron manacle that forms part of a mystical network, allowing communication between agents in the field. The shackle also serves a more sinister purpose, permanently binding each monster to the service of the agency and preventing the more unhinged members from acting out during missions.

Jonathon Gravehouse looked too long and too hard into the dark places of the world. Until something looked back that left him forever changed. Human frailty consumed by terrible secrets, an inhuman presence now resides within the shell of Jonathon Gravehouse. A presence able to drive a normal man to madness and death with just a whisper of the forbidden knowledge it contains.

A longstanding agent of The Chain, Gravehouse declared himself retired seven years ago and has spent the time since in seclusion at his lake-side manor in New England. Events are about to conspire to cut his retirement much shorter than he intended.

Once the daughter of the governor of Hong Kong, Charlotte died an unnatural death at the age of seventeen. She’s haunted the mirrors and shadows of Hong Kong ever since, a pale young English rose with long black hair that hangs across her face and hides her eyes from view. To see Charlotte’s grinning reflection in your mirror is to know fear; to see into her eyes is to know instant, horrific death.

As an agent of The Chain, Charlotte’s ability to travel through mirrors makes her a valuable espionage asset. Seven years ago she was part of a team of agents operating under Gravehouse’s command, alongside Cowboy 13 and Creeping Henry.

An unstoppable psychopath in a zipped-shut gimp mask and cowboy hat. And we do mean unstoppable – the residents of Granbury, Texas have tried just about everything on Cowboy 13 over the years. They’ve decapitated him, burned him, drowned him, electrocuted him (twice) and he just keeps coming back.

The Cowboy never speaks, but he will communicate when pressed through simple hand gestures. It thus remains unclear whether he works for The Chain of his own free will or purely under the coercion of his shackle. At any rate, Cowboy 13 gets to kill new people in interesting places and for now this seems to be enough to keep him happy.

The daughter of Creeping Henry, a famous dream-stalker who long terrorised the town of Oakwood, Massachusetts before finally being dispatched to Hell by a group of meddling teenagers. Tuesday has inherited her father’s ability to enter the dreams of her victims and kill them as they sleep. A young black woman with piercing eyes, in dreams Tuesday becomes a twisted, dark reflection of her waking form.

Creeping Tuesday is the newest and most reluctant member of The Chain, shackled into service by Gravehouse to replace her missing father. She’s also the most sympathetic of our monsters, having only used her abilities up till now against the absolute worst dregs of humanity.
